Pragmatic Tuning Prism is used during Horadric Cube Transmutations to influence item modifications toward utility and mobility-related affixes.
Rather than focusing on offense or defense, this prism is designed for players who want greater convenience, mobility, and overall efficiency while navigating combat encounters.
It can be especially useful when refining gear for builds that rely on repositioning quickly or making better use of utility-focused bonuses.
Where To Get Pragmatic Tuning Prism?
Cube Spoils earned through War Plans can reward Pragmatic Tuning Prisms, making them one of the more reliable sources for this crafting material.
Tree of Whispers caches may also provide Pragmatic Tuning Prisms when claimed after completing enough Grim Favors.
You can also find these prisms from Elite monsters encountered throughout Sanctuary, allowing them to accumulate naturally while farming other rewards.
Pragmatic Tuning Prism Uses
Pragmatic Tuning Prism shifts Horadric Cube Transmutations toward effects that change how a build moves and functions in actual combat flow.
Instead of strengthening raw power or defenses, it leans into stats that improve pacing, positioning, and overall control during fights.
It’s typically used when a build already works mechanically but feels too slow, clunky, or restricted in moment-to-moment gameplay.
Item Types & Affixes
Utility and mobility affixes show up on a pretty wide range of gear, depending on the slot and what kind of stats it’s allowed to roll.
Movement Speed usually lands on boots and a few other pieces where getting around faster actually changes how smooth the build feels in real fights.
Cooldown Reduction tends to show up on helmets, amulets, and similar slots where shaving time off your skills makes the whole rotation feel less clunky.
Evade-related bonuses are all about movement in combat, letting you dodge, reposition, and avoid getting locked down when things get hectic.
Other utility effects don’t hit harder or tank more damage, but they make the build feel way more responsive and easier to play overall.
